Diagnostic Medical Sonographer salary in Missouri

Median $76,870 · Top 10% earn $91,630+ · Roughly 1,684 workers in Missouri. Source: BLS OEWS, May 2024.

Missouri pays modestly below the U.S. median for diagnostic medical sonographers — $76,870 versus the national median of $84,470. Missouri's lower cost of living means the salary stretches further — real purchasing power is about $2,095 above the U.S. average. The state employs roughly 1,684 diagnostic medical sonographers.

Diagnostic Medical Sonographer salary in Missouri — FAQ

What is the average diagnostic medical sonographer salary in Missouri?
The median diagnostic medical sonographer salary in Missouri is $76,870 per year (BLS OEWS, May 2024). The bottom 10% earn around $56,630; the top 10% earn $91,630 or more. About 1,684 people work in this role across the state.
How does Missouri diagnostic medical sonographer pay compare to the national average?
Missouri's median of $76,870 is $7,600 below the U.S. national median of $84,470. After adjusting for Missouri's cost of living (Regional Price Parity 88.8), the real-purchasing-power equivalent is $86,565.
Is diagnostic medical sonographer a good career in Missouri?
On the data: Missouri employs roughly 1,684 diagnostic medical sonographers, with a median wage of $76,870 and the top decile clearing $91,630. The role is projected to grow +11% nationally over the next decade. Whether it's "good" for you depends on whether the work suits you and whether you're positioned for the in-state metros that pay above the median.
What's the hourly rate for diagnostic medical sonographers in Missouri?
At the Missouri median of $76,870 annually, the equivalent hourly rate is approximately $36.96/hr. The top 10% earn around $44.05/hr, while entry-level roles typically pay $27.23/hr or slightly above.

Methodology note

Missouri-level wage data sourced from BLS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ics, May 2024 release (SOC 29-2032: Diagnostic Medical Sonographers), with state pay indexes from BLS area-comparison tables. Cost-of-living adjustments use BEA Regional Price Parities, 2023 release, where Missouri's RPP is 88.8 (U.S. = 100). Last reviewed: May 2026.
